Some consumers give new meaning to the term “dumbbell.”

Seems a few purchasers of chrome dumbbells neglected to tightly secure the 2- to 50-pound weights to their handles.

The consequences, reported by the U.S. Consumer Product Safety Commission, were bruises and broken noses and toes to five human dumbbells.

Now some l.1 million of the Reebok and NordicTrack sets--sold between June 2000 and May 2004 by sporting-goods dealers--have been recalled voluntarily.
